This question is about hair stylist demographics.

What percentage of Hair Stylists are female?

By Zippia Team - Mar. 10, 2022

79.8% of hair stylists are female in the United States. This is -0.9 percentage points lower than last year. Additionally, the percentage of female hair stylists has decreased by -4.1 percentage points since 2010. That means there are a total of 291,861 female hair stylists in the U.S. and 73,880 male hair stylists in the United States. Note that Zippia's estimate accounts only for the 365,741 people with the specific job title of hair stylist and doesn't include grouping similar job titles, or people with potentially similar credentialing.

Additionally, female hair stylists tend to be younger than male hair stylists. The average age of a female hair stylist is 39.6, while the average age of a male hair stylist is 43.0.

While the majority of U.S. hair stylists are female in 2022, there are still some occupations where males dominate. For example, 70% of barber shop manager are male. On the other hand, some hair stylist jobs are dominated by females. 85% of electrologist, for instance, are female.

Like most jobs, there's a gender pay gap among hair stylists. The average male hair stylist earns an average annual salary of $37,783, while the average female hair stylist earns an average annual income of $35,817, meaning female hair stylists make 95 cents for every dollar a man earns.
